The verdict is out in the second federal corruption trial of former Illinois Governor Rod Blagojevich. His fortune wasn't as good this time around. The jury found him guilty on 17 of the 18 counts that it could reach an agreement on, including but not limited to his attempt to sell President Obama's old Senate seat.

A wildfire in New Mexico is now less than one mile from the Los Alamos National Laboratory — where nuclear weapons and other fun things are developed — and a spokesman from the Santa Fe National Forest called it a "very, very big concern, not only locally but nationally and globally."
